Output 86f5a73c788705c3e3c0145f7caf55bd341fa88adee2e6547a6fa26736cbef30:0

value
2588494
script pubkey
OP_0 OP_PUSHBYTES_20 de536110f2f6b4ac5ed49d4711fe5b10c41f7da2
address
bc1qmefkzy8j7662chk5n4r3rljmzrzp7ldzgu0p8y
transaction
86f5a73c788705c3e3c0145f7caf55bd341fa88adee2e6547a6fa26736cbef30
spent
true